The peak voltage of the AC source is equal to:
1. \(1 / \sqrt{2}\) times the rms value of the AC source.
2. the value of voltage supplied to the circuit.
3. the rms value of the AC source.
4. \(\sqrt{2}\) times the rms value of the AC source.

A standard filament lamp consumes \(100~\text W\) when connected to \(200~\text V\) AC mains supply. The peak current through the bulb will be:
1. \(0.707~\text A\) 
2. \(1~\text A\) 
3. \(1.414~\text A\) 
4. \(2~\text A\)

A \(40~\mu\text F\) capacitor is connected to a \(200~\text V,\)  \(50~\text{Hz}\) AC supply. The RMS value of the current in the circuit is, nearly:
1. \(2.05~\text A\)
2. \(2.5~\text A\)
3. \(25.1~\text A\)
4. \(1.7~\text A\)
